Comparison Summary

1. Specifications Comparison

Here's a detailed comparison of the specifications of the Xiaomi Redmi Note 9T and the ZTE nubia Z60 Ultra, with a focus on the practical implications of each difference:

FeatureXiaomi Redmi Note 9TZTE nubia Z60 UltraPractical Impact
Design
Dimensions161.2 × 77.3 × 9.1 mm164 × 76.4 × 8.8 mmThe ZTE is slightly taller and thinner. The size difference is barely noticeable in daily use.
Weight199g246gThe Redmi Note 9T is significantly lighter, which makes it more comfortable for one-handed use and extended periods.
Display
Size6.53"6.8"The ZTE has a slightly larger screen, offering a more immersive viewing experience for videos and games.
Resolution1080x23401116x2480The ZTE has a slightly sharper display. The difference is noticeable to a trained eye but may be negligible for most casual users.
PPI395400Both have very similar pixel density, meaning sharpness is almost identical.
TechnologyIPS LCDAMOLEDThe ZTE's AMOLED display offers superior contrast, deeper blacks, and more vibrant colors, making it much better for media consumption.
Refresh Rate60Hz120HzThe ZTE's 120Hz refresh rate offers much smoother scrolling and animations, enhancing the user experience, especially while gaming.
Brightness0 nits1500 nitsThe ZTE's display is significantly brighter making it much easier to view in direct sunlight, ideal for outdoor use.
Performance
ChipsetMediatek Dimensity 800U (7 nm)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 (4 nm)The ZTE has a much more powerful processor that can handle demanding tasks such as high-end gaming and video editing with ease, and is more future proof.
Antutu Score343,1502,017,588The ZTE has a substantially higher benchmark score indicating significantly better performance, and faster app loading.
GPUMali-G57 MC3Adreno 750The ZTE's GPU is much more powerful, leading to better gaming performance and smoother graphics rendering.
Battery
Capacity5000mAh6000mAhThe ZTE's larger battery is more likely to last a full day of heavy usage. The extra 1000 mAh capacity is likely to provide a noticeably better battery endurance.
Charging18W fast charging80W fast chargingThe ZTE charges significantly faster, reducing downtime waiting for your phone to charge.
Camera
Standard Camera48MP f/1.7954MP f/1.6ZTE has better low light capabilities with a larger sensor and wider aperture. It will produce sharper images with more details.
Selfie Camera13MP f/2.2512MP f/2.0The ZTE has a better selfie camera in low light with a wider aperture and larger sensor.
Telephoto LensNone64MP f/3.3The ZTE's telephoto lens provides optical zoom capabilities, useful for portrait shots and zooming in on distant subjects.
Wide Angle LensNone50MP f/1.8The ZTE's wide-angle lens allows for capturing more expansive scenes.
Portrait mode (depth)2MP f/2.4NoneThe Xiaomi has a dedicated depth sensor for portrait shots.
Macro Lens2MP f/2.4NoneThe Xiaomi has a dedicated macro lens for close-up shots.
Video4K@30fps, 1080p@60fps8K@30fps, 4K@120fpsThe ZTE supports higher video resolution and frame rates with better image stabilization, making it much better for video recording.
Software
OSAndroid 10Android 14The ZTE has a much newer OS version, providing access to the latest features and security updates.
Connectivity
Wi-FiWi-Fi 5Wi-Fi 7The ZTE supports the latest Wi-Fi standards, offering faster speeds and improved performance on compatible networks.
BluetoothBluetooth 5.1 LEBluetooth 5.4 LEThe ZTE has a newer version of Bluetooth, offering better performance, efficiency and newer features.
GPSGPS, A-GPS, Galileo, GLONASSA-GPS, GLONASS, Beidou, QZSS, GPS (L1+L5), Galileo (E1+E5a)The ZTE offers more satellite system support, resulting in more accurate and reliable positioning.
SIMDual SIM Dual StandbyDual SIM Dual StandbyBoth phones support dual SIM functionality, allowing the use of two different networks simultaneously.
Storage
Internal Storage64GB or 128GB256GB, 512GB, or 1024GBThe ZTE has significantly more storage space for apps, photos, and videos.
RAM4GB8GB, 12GB, 16GB or 24GBThe ZTE offers significantly more RAM, allowing for better multitasking and performance with demanding apps.
Expandable StorageNoNoNeither phone offers expandable storage, so users are limited to the built-in memory.
Audio
Audio QualityHi-Res Audio, Stereo SpeakersDTS / DTS X, Stereo Speakers, 3 microphonesZTE has slightly better quality sound features, especially due to DTS.
Security
Featuresside-mounted fingerprint sensorbasic fingerprint sensorXiaomi has a more advanced side-mounted fingerprint sensor, for faster unlocks.
Build Quality
Screen ProtectionCorning Gorilla Glass 5Corning Gorilla Glass 5Both phones have same screen protection technology.
Sensors
FeaturesAccelerometer, Compass, Gyroscope, Ultrasonic proximity virtualAccelerometer, Compass, Gyroscope, Proximity, Gravity, RGBZTE has more variety in sensors to support a wider range of features.

2. Key Differences Analysis

Xiaomi Redmi Note 9T Advantages:

  • Lighter Weight: At 199g, it is significantly lighter than the ZTE (246g) making it more comfortable for extended use, one handed use and carrying it in pockets.
  • Side Mounted Fingerprint Sensor: Faster and more practical unlock than regular fingerprint sensor

ZTE nubia Z60 Ultra Advantages:

  • Superior Display: AMOLED panel with 120Hz refresh rate and higher brightness provides a much better viewing experience with vivid colors and smoother animations. Much easier to see in direct sunlight.
  • Significantly Higher Performance: The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 chipset with a dramatically higher AnTuTu score results in far superior processing power, and thus better multitasking, gaming and app performance making it a better future-proof option.
  • Advanced Camera System: Includes a telephoto and wide-angle lens, along with higher resolution and better sensor technology for both main and selfie cameras, offering superior photo and video quality and more versatility, including 8k recording.
  • Larger Battery & Faster Charging: The 6000mAh battery, paired with 80W fast charging, ensures longer battery life and much quicker recharges.
  • Newer Software: Runs on Android 14, providing access to the latest features, security updates, and improvements.
  • More Storage and RAM: Offers significantly more internal storage and RAM, resulting in better multitasking performance and app performance.
  • Better Connectivity: Supports the newest Wi-Fi and Bluetooth standards.

Trade-offs:

  • Weight: The ZTE is heavier, which may make it less comfortable to hold and carry for some users.
  • No Macro Lens: Unlike the Xiaomi, the ZTE lacks a dedicated Macro Lens
  • No Portrait Mode (depth): Unlike the Xiaomi, the ZTE lacks a dedicated portrait depth sensor
